What affects the price

Remodeling costs depend on the scope of the project. Simply resurfacing your pool is significantly cheaper than a full overhaul that includes changing the layout, adding features like a spa, or installing new tile and coping. The materials you choose—such as standard plaster versus high-end aggregate finishes—also shift the total. Additionally, the current condition of your plumbing and pool equipment plays a big role; updating old systems adds to the labor and parts required. About this service

These professionals handle major structural changes to your backyard. You need a contractor when you are ready to completely renovate an existing pool, add custom features like spas or waterfalls, or rebuild a shell that has fallen into disrepair. They manage the permits, heavy equipment, and specialized trades required for significant construction. What time of year is best to resurface a pool?

The best time to resurface a pool in Virginia Beach is typically during the cooler months, like fall or early spring. This allows for ideal curing conditions and often means shorter wait times for contractors. However, pros are often available year-round to get your pool ready for the season.
